On 10/11/2010 05:30 PM, Stefan Hajnoczi wrote:
>
> It was discussed before, but I don't think we came to a conclusion. Are
> there any circumstances under which you don't want to set the
> QED_CF_BACKING_FORMAT flag?
I suggest the following:
QED_CF_BACKING_FORMAT_RAW = 0x1
When set, the backing file is a raw image and should not be probed for
its file format. The default (unset) means that the backing image file
format may be probed.
Now the backing_fmt_{offset,size} are no longer necessary.
Should it not be an incompatible option? If the backing disk starts
with a format magic, it will be probed by an older qemu, incorrectly.
